United to launch Rome-Chicago route

25 Nov 2009 by Mark Caswell
United Airlines will fly daily from Rome to its Chicago hub during the 2010 summer season. The route will operate between May 1 and Aug 31, 2010, with the outbound flight departing Rome at 1230, arriving into Chicago at 1605. The return leg leaves the US at 1825, landing back into Rome at 1040 the following day. Flights will be served by United’s Boeing 767 aircraft, featuring the carrier’s flat bed seating (click here for reviews of the product). The new service is in addition to United’s existing daily flight between Rome and Washington Dulles. Alitalia currently offers six flights per week between Rome and Chicago, while American Airlines also offers a daily service between the two cities. For more information visit united.com.
